How Urethral Stricture Treatment Can Enhance Your Health and Wellness

Urethral stricture is a condition characterized by the narrowing of the urethra, often due to scar tissue, injury, or inflammation. This condition can lead to a variety of symptoms, including painful urination, difficulty emptying the bladder, and recurrent urinary tract infections. Seeking prompt treatment for urethral stricture is crucial as it can significantly enhance your overall health and wellness.

Treatment options for urethral stricture may include minimally invasive procedures, such as dilation or urethrotomy, to restore normal urinary function. More severe cases may require a urethral reconstruction or the use of a urethral stent. By addressing the stricture, patients can improve their urinary flow, reduce discomfort, and lower the risk of complications associated with delayed treatment.

One of the primary benefits of urethral stricture treatment is the restoration of healthy urinary function. Improved urinary flow enhances bladder emptying, which can prevent urinary retention. This is critical as chronic urinary retention can lead to kidney damage and infections, emphasizing the importance of timely intervention.

Moreover, resolving urethral stricture can lead to significant improvements in quality of life. Many patients express that they can engage more fully in daily activities and social interactions without the burden of frequent bathroom trips or discomfort. Enhanced sexual function is another potential benefit, as urethral strictures can negatively impact sexual health and intimacy.

Additionally, treating urethral stricture can lead to better overall health. By eliminating recurrent urinary tract infections and potential kidney damage, individuals can reduce their need for antibiotics, which can contribute to antibiotic resistance. This shift towards a more stable health condition allows for a more proactive approach to wellness.

Early diagnosis and treatment are key components in managing urethral stricture. If you experience symptoms such as a weak urine stream, urgency, or frequent urinary infections, it is essential to consult a healthcare professional. A urologist can offer a tailored treatment plan based on the severity and location of the stricture.
